Adam Madison, seated left, and Ashley Hicks, standing right, of Venza Care greet a nurse ready to let loose at Goat Island at Nurses’ Night on Saturday, Aug. 5, 2023. (Cayla Grace Murphy)

CULLMAN, Ala. – Nurses of all ages descended on Goat Island Brewing late Saturday evening to ditch the scrubs, let loose and relax. With beertenders pouring out frosty brews, local band Razz Matazz playing upbeat covers of all the classics and Mom & M’s dishing out tasty twists on Southern favorites, the night was a major hit. 

Said Ashley Hicks, organizer of the event and administrator of Venza Care at Falkville Health and Rehab Center, “We just wanted to come out tonight and show our appreciation for all the nurses in the county. If they have any needs, we just wanted everyone to know that this resource is here for them.” 

Goat Island Brewing Co-Owner Brad Glenn said the event was fairly indicative of the culture at the Goat as a whole. “Our owners and staff, we’re all about community,” he said. “So this is just another opportunity for our community to give back to our first responders, and hey, the more the merrier!”
